Abstract

The study paper delves into the transformative impact of Artificial Intelligence (AI) on financial management, highlighting the significant opportunities, challenges, and regulatory implications involved. AI technologies like machine learning, natural language processing, and robotic process automation are transforming financial sectors by enhancing decision-making, operational efficiency, and customer personalization. The study employs a mixed-methods approach, integrating or connecting quantitative data from surveys with qualitative insights from semi-structured interviews with financial industry stakeholders. The results indicate a positive correlation between AI adoption and operational efficiency, with AI-driven automation and advanced analytics leading to improved profitability and customer satisfaction. However, challenges such as data privacy, algorithmic bias, and the opacity of AI systems pose significant hurdles. Regulatory concerns focus on ensuring transparency, fairness, and data protection in AI applications, with a call for updated governance models to keep pace with technological advancements. The paper emphasizes the need for ongoing research into AI's long-term effects on the financial industry, advocating for robust AI governance frameworks and a deeper exploration of AI’s impact on market dynamics and employment within the sector. This comprehensive analysis aims to provide a balanced perspective on the potential and limitations of AI in financial management.
